No traffic touring cycling routes around Marcilly offer a diverse landscape for outdoor enthusiasts. The region features varied terrain, including valley views and foothills, providing a mix of inclines, descents, and flat stretches. Cyclists can also encounter remnants of old canals, adding a historical dimension to the routes. Surrounding areas suggest the likelihood of forests and picturesque ponds, offering shaded paths and tranquil spots.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ic touring cycling routes are available in Marcilly?

There are over 75 dedicated no-traffic touring cycling routes around Marcilly, offering a wide variety of experiences. These routes are designed to provide peaceful rides away from vehicular traffic.

What do other touring cyclists say about the no-traffic routes in Marcilly?

The no-traffic touring routes in Marcilly are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.2 stars from over 65 reviews. Cyclists frequently praise the varied terrain, scenic views, and the tranquility of riding away from cars.

Are there easy no-traffic touring routes suitable for beginners?

Yes, Marcilly offers a good selection of easy no-traffic touring routes, with 26 routes specifically categorized as easy. An example is the Bike loop from Oissery, which is relatively short and has minimal elevation gain, perfect for a relaxed ride.

Can I find more challenging no-traffic touring routes in Marcilly?

Absolutely. For those seeking a greater challenge, there are 24 difficult no-traffic touring routes available. These routes often feature longer distances and more significant elevation changes, such as the Mémorial US air force – Jb loop from Oissery, which includes over 250 meters of ascent.

What natural features can I expect to see on these no-traffic routes?

The no-traffic touring routes around Marcilly showcase a diverse landscape. You can expect varied terrain, picturesque valley views, and gentle foothills. Some paths may follow old canal routes, offering a unique historical perspective, while others wind through tranquil forests and past serene ponds, providing shaded and peaceful sections.

Are there historical landmarks or points of interest along the no-traffic cycling routes?

Yes, the region is rich in history and culture. Along or near these routes, you might encounter significant landmarks. For instance, you could cycle past the impressive Meaux Cathedral or explore sections of the Ourcq Towpath, which offers a glimpse into historical waterways. The broader region also features châteaux and other historical sites.

Are the no-traffic touring routes in Marcilly suitable for families?

Many of the easy and moderate no-traffic routes are well-suited for families, especially those looking for safe and enjoyable rides away from cars. Routes with gentler gradients and shorter distances, like the Bike loop from Oissery, are ideal for family outings.

Can I bring my dog on these no-traffic cycling routes?

While many natural paths are generally dog-friendly, it's always best to check specific route regulations or local signage, especially in protected areas or private lands. When cycling with a dog, ensure they are well-behaved, on a leash where required, and that you carry water for them.

Where can I find parking near the starting points of these no-traffic routes?

Parking availability varies by starting point. Many villages and towns that serve as access points for these routes, such as Oissery or Varreddes, typically offer public parking. It's advisable to check specific route descriptions on komoot for details on recommended parking areas near the trailhead.

Are there less crowded no-traffic routes for a peaceful ride?

Yes, given the abundance of no-traffic routes, it's possible to find less crowded options, especially during off-peak seasons or weekdays. Routes that venture deeper into rural areas or forests, such as those near the Montgé-en-Goële Regional Forest, tend to offer a more serene cycling experience.

What is the best time of year to cycle the no-traffic touring routes in Marcilly?

Spring and autumn are generally considered the best seasons for touring cycling in Marcilly. The weather is typically mild, and the natural scenery is at its most vibrant. Summer can also be pleasant, but it's advisable to start early to avoid the midday heat. Winter cycling is possible, but some paths might be muddy or less accessible.

Are there any circular no-traffic touring routes available?

Yes, many of the no-traffic touring routes in Marcilly are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point without retracing your steps. Examples include the Varreddes Church – Church of Congis-sur-Thérouane loop from Varreddes and the Route Under the Trees – Mémorial US air force loop from Oissery.
